Junior Riah Nelsen was dominant as he struck out 16 batters and walked none on Monday night and Greene County won in Colfax by a 3-1 final over Colfax-Mingo in Heart of Iowa Activities Conference baseball. Nelsen did hit three batters with pitches during the complete game performance, and the Tigerhawks put together three bloop singles, and used an error to score and unearned run in the fifth inning. Nelsen fanned 11 of the first 12 batters he faced and he had a perfect game through four innings.
The Rams scored twice in the third inning and once in the sixth. Greene County benefited from three errors, a Nelsen SAC fly, and a passed ball to take a 2-0 lead. Daric Whipple singled in the third run for the Rams. Alex Rasmussen singled for the only other Greene County hit. C-M had four errors, while the Rams had just one. Greene County had other scoring chances, but the Rams left 10 runners on base, all in scoring position.
The win puts Greene County at 5-8 in the conference and 5-11 overall, while C-M fell to 2-11 in the HOIAC.
